Method for installing steel column in limited space
The invention relates to a method for installing a steel column in a limited space. The limited space is formed below a supporting floor slab arranged in a foundation pit, and the supporting floor slab is arranged on a support in the foundation pit. The method is characterized by comprising the steps that a tower crane is provided and installed at the pit bottom of the foundation pit; a through hole matched with a steel wire rope of the tower crane is formed in the position, corresponding to the to-be-installed position of the steel column in the limited space, of the supporting floor slab; the steel column is conveyed to the to-be-installed position; the steel wire rope of the tower crane penetrates through the through hole and is connected with the steel column in an installed mode; andthe steel column is hoisted to the to-be-installed position through the tower crane and installed and fixed. The problem that the steel column located below the supporting floor slab cannot be directly hoisted through the tower crane is solved.
